Safeguarding the Legacy: A Multifaceted Approach to Preserving African Cultural Heritage

The vibrant tapestry of African culture, rich in history, artistry, and tradition, faces the relentless tide of globalization. However, the preservation of this invaluable heritage isn't merely a nostalgic endeavor; it's a vital act of safeguarding identity, fostering pride, and inspiring future generations. This requires a concerted and multifaceted approach, encompassing both tangible and intangible aspects of our shared legacy. The following strategies offer a pathway towards ensuring the enduring legacy of African culture.

1. The Enduring Power of Oral Tradition: Storytelling, the cornerstone of many African societies, serves as a living archive of ancestral wisdom, myths, and historical accounts. Actively engaging in and documenting oral traditions ensures the continuation of this invaluable knowledge transmission.

2. Archiving Cultural Artifacts: Meticulous documentation of historical artifacts – their origin, significance, and associated narratives – is paramount. This creates a comprehensive record, enabling future generations to appreciate their cultural and historical weight.

3. Integrating Cultural Education: Formal education must actively incorporate African history, art, and cultural practices into its curriculum. Empowering youth with this knowledge fosters a sense of ownership and responsibility towards their heritage.

4. Establishing Cultural Centers: Dedicated cultural centers serve as vibrant hubs, showcasing African art, music, dance, and literature. These spaces provide platforms for education, community engagement, and the celebration of diverse cultural expressions.

5. Supporting Traditional Artisans: African artisans are the custodians of countless traditional crafts. By actively supporting their work, both financially and through patronage, we ensure the survival of these invaluable skills and traditions for future generations.

6. Fostering International Collaboration: Partnerships with international museums, universities, and cultural organizations facilitate knowledge exchange, promote cross-cultural understanding, and offer global platforms for showcasing African heritage.

7. Leveraging Digital Technologies: The digital realm offers unparalleled opportunities to share African cultural traditions globally. Websites, social media platforms, and online exhibitions expand the reach and accessibility of our heritage.

8. Celebrating Cultural Festivals: Vibrant cultural festivals provide opportunities for showcasing the diverse traditions across the African continent. These events promote unity, pride, and a deeper appreciation of cultural diversity.

9. Preserving Traditional Music and Dance: Music and dance are integral components of African culture. Supporting local musicians and dancers, and actively documenting traditional rhythms and movements, safeguards these vital art forms.

10. Revitalizing Indigenous Languages: Language is the bedrock of culture. Promoting and revitalizing indigenous African languages ensures their continued use and transmission to future generations, strengthening cultural identity.

11. Protecting Sacred Sites: The preservation of sacred sites – ancient temples, burial grounds, and significant natural landmarks – is crucial. These places hold profound cultural and historical value and demand careful safeguarding.

12. Engaging Youth in Cultural Activities: Active involvement of youth in traditional dance classes, art workshops, and language lessons fosters a sense of pride and ownership of their heritage, shaping them into future cultural ambassadors.

13. Establishing Cultural Exchange Programs: Cultural exchange programs between African nations facilitate the sharing of skills, traditions, and artistic practices, enriching the continent's diverse cultural landscape.

14. Promoting Culturally-Focused Tourism: Responsible tourism that highlights African cultural heritage creates economic opportunities for local communities while simultaneously promoting appreciation for their traditions.

15. Advocating for Supportive Cultural Policies: Strong cultural policies at national and continental levels are essential for prioritizing the preservation and promotion of African cultural heritage, ensuring its continuity.

Nelson Mandela eloquently stated, "A nation without a culture is a nation without a soul." By embracing our diverse traditions, celebrating our unique identities, and fostering pan-African unity, we create a future where our rich cultural heritage thrives and inspires generations to come.
